Operations and Methods
The following method-implemented operations are supported for the resellers entities in Veeam Service Provider Console RESTful API:
- Get All Resellers — retrieve a collection resource representation of all resellers.
- Create Reseller — create a new reseller with specific properties.
- Get Reseller — retrieve a resource representation of a reseller with the specified UID.
- Modify Reseller — modify a reseller with the specified UID.
- Delete Reseller — delete a reseller with the specified UID.
- Get Reseller Permissions — retrieve a resource representation of the Veeam Service Provider Console components that a reseller with the specified UID can access.
- Modify Reseller Permissions — modify set of the Veeam Service Provider Console components that a reseller with the specified UID can access.
- Send Welcome Email to Reseller — send a welcome email to a reseller with the specified UID.
- Get All Companies Managed by Reseller — retrieve a collection resource representation of companies managed by a reseller with the specified UID.
- Assign Company to Reseller — assign a company to a reseller with the specified UID.
- Unassign Company from Reseller — unassign a company from a reseller with the specified UID.
- Get All Reseller Site Resources — retrieve a collection resource representation of managed companies quotas configured for all resellers.
- Get All Site Resources Configured for Reseller — retrieve a collection resource representation of managed companies quotas configured for a reseller with the specified UID on all sites.
- Create Reseller Site Resource — create a managed companies quota for a reseller with the specified UID.
- Get Reseller Site Resource — retrieve a resource representation of a managed companies quota configured for a reseller on the site with the specified UID.
- Modify Reseller Site Resource — modify a managed companies quota configured for a reseller on the site with the specified UID.
- Delete Reseller Site Resource — delete a managed companies quota configured for a reseller on the site with the specified UID.
- Get All Reseller Backup Resources — retrieve a collection resource representation of all reseller cloud backup resources.
- Get All Backup Resources Allocated to Reseller on Specific Site — retrieve a collection resource representation of all cloud backup resources allocated to a reseller on a site with the specified UID.
- Get Reseller Backup Resource — retrieve a resource representation of a reseller cloud backup resource with the specified UID.
- Get All Reseller Replication Resources — retrieve a collection resource representation of all reseller cloud replication resources.
- Get All Replication Resources Allocated to Reseller on Specific Site — retrieve a collection resource representation of all cloud replication resources allocated to a reseller on a site with the specified UID.
- Get Reseller Replication Resource — retrieve a resource representation of a reseller cloud replication resource with the specified UID.
- Get Resellers vCD Replication Resources — retrieve a collection resource representation of all reseller vCD replication resources.
- Get All vCD Replication Resources Allocated to Reseller on Specific Site — retrieve a collection resource representation of all vCD replication resources allocated to a reseller on a site with the specified UID.
- Get Reseller vCD Replication Resource — retrieve a resource representation of a reseller vCD replication resource with the specified UID.